Abstract

The utility model provides a kind of battery pack, including two groups of battery cores and respectively four electrode terminals of electric connection corresponding with the positive electrode and negative electrode of two groups of battery cores.Four electrode terminals include two fixing terminals for being set to two variable terminals of centre and being set to outside.Two variable terminals have different mechanical connection states, two groups of battery cores can be made in being connected in series or in parallel, so that battery pack exports two different voltages.The utility model additionally provides a kind of electric tool system, including electric tool and battery pack.The mating mechanical connection state for switching variable terminal of the male plug part and battery pack of electric tool, so that battery pack exports different output voltages to electric tool.So set, increasing the scope of application of electric tool system, the compatibility of product is improved, development cost is reduced.

Background technique
The electrically powered machines such as electric tool rechargeable battery a group driving, motor using lithium ion battery etc. more and more The wireless penetration of device becomes an important development trend.In the electric tool driven by motor, usually using by multiple batteries The battery pack of unit composition, and the electric energy by storing in battery pack is come drive motor.It is reduced using rear voltage, it can be by battery pack It removes from electric tool, is charged using external recharging apparatus to battery pack.
In the electric tool or electrically powered machine of radio-type, need rechargeable battery can ensure as defined in the working time or Defined output, therefore the performance of battery will also meet high output or Towards Higher Voltage.In addition, with to by radio-type motor The exploitation of device, the battery pack with various output voltages have also gradually been commercialized.In general, the output voltage of battery pack is fixed , but occur at present by the way that multiple battery components are arranged, and select by connecting component to export battery component series connection, Or export battery component parallel connection, electric tool or electrically powered machine in need of different voltages are coped with this.
For user, when using multiple electric tools or electrically powered machine, to prepare multiple battery group in response to not Same voltage requirements, so can be comparatively laborious, and it is therefore desirable to provide the batteries that one kind can export different voltages by switching Group improves the convenience used.
